Flashcards

Linear Inequality in Two Variables

An inequality in the form Ax + By < C or Ax + By > C where A, B, and C are constants, and x and y are variables.

Solution Set (Inequality)

The set of all points (x, y) that make the inequality true.

Graphing a Linear Inequality

Shading the region of the coordinate plane that satisfies the inequality.

Boundary Line (Inequality)

The line created by changing the inequality symbol to an equal sign.
